Staffordshire County Cricket Club’s Development XI kick off their season on Monday with their first North of England Cup clash.
Staffs pay a visit to their Northumberland counterparts at Burnopfield for the 50 overs per side contest.
Staffs will be captained by Matthew Morris. He is involved in their first-team squad for the NCCA Twenty20 Cup on Sunday.
Sam Atkinson and Tom Moulton are the other members of the senior party who will line up in the fixture.
There is plenty of young talent for Staffordshire to cast their over, who have all been involved in winter training.
Hem Heath’s Callum Leese is one to keep an eye on. He made an impression for the NSSCL XI in their warm-up game against Staffordshire at Caverswall earlier this month. Leese hit five sixes in an unbeaten 48 in the first match.
Moddershall & Oulton seamer Sam Atkinson forms part of the county’s attack. Atkinson has recently been awarded a place on the Warwickshire Academy.
Bridgnorth’s Rahaul Kaushal, West Bromwich Dartmouth’s Gurjot Singh and Pelsall’s Harmandeep Singh Baath are in the side.
Staffordshire Development XI: Matthew Morris (Westhoughton), Sam Atkinson (Moddershall & Oulton); Jacob Degg (Porthill Park), Jacob Garlick (Longton), Clark Haddrell (Checkley), Jack Hammond (Meakins), Rahaul Kaushal (Bridgnorth), Callum Leese (Hem Heath), Tom Moulton (Checkley), Gurjot Singh (West Bromwich Dartmouth), Harmandeep Singh Baath (Pelsall).
